**Ticket: AuditScope viewer truncates plugin-emitted entries**

External plugins writing to the Fennick AuditScope log viewer report that entries over 2 KB are silently truncated, cutting off structured payloads mid-field. This affects any plugin using the extended metadata hook introduced in the Larkspur release. Workaround: split payloads across multiple entries until the fix lands. Plugin authors can reproduce with the sample harness in the developer kit. The affected viewer build is listed directly below for reference.

build token for tawip-yageg: htk9_92ac43d42

Handover note — Crumbwheel order cutoffs.

Welcome aboard. The bakery cutoff rule in Crumbwheel closes same-day orders at 14:00 local to each storefront, not UTC — this has bitten us twice. Holiday overrides live in the calendar service and take precedence silently, so always check there first when a cutoff looks wrong. To unlock the calendar service's admin console after a restart, enter the recovery passphrase below.

vault phrase of bagap-bahaf = silion-pelox-sorox-casdor-quenwyn-fraax-eliox-praael-kelion-quenvan-kasox-rusael-norius-belvan

The orphaned-resource sweeper (Gleanery) scans project namespaces every six hours and flags volumes, snapshots, and load balancers with no owning deployment. Support staff investigating a customer report should first check the sweeper's audit log via GET /v1/sweeps before assuming data loss. All requests to the Gleanery endpoint require authentication against the internal ops gateway, using the service key provided immediately below.

API key for fahip-kahip: zpat23_XiJGUHz5xfaAtaIqUkus0rh

Penceflow environments — idempotency keys for payment retries. Each environment (dev, staging, prod) enforces its own key TTL and retry window; staging intentionally uses a short TTL to surface duplicate-charge bugs before the weekly sync. Keys are scoped per merchant, never global. For staging, the retry subsystem must be configured with the values listed below.

settings of tagef-bawif:
DRUIX_HOST=druix.zemvarlabs.internal
DRUIX_PORT=8000